Gevo Technology Mitigates Effects of Climate Change Identified in US Government Report

December 3, 2018 By Technologies.org Leave a Comment

Gevo’s low-carbon sustainable fuels reduce greenhouse gas emissions

Gevo, Inc. (NASDAQ: GEVO) announced today that the US Global Change Research Program recently published the Fourth National Climate Assessment report on climate (2018: Impacts, Risks, and Adaptation in the United States: Fourth National Climate Assessment, Volume II: Report in Brief) which is available at https://nca2018.globalchange.gov/. The report which is mandated by statute to be produced and provided to Congress and the President at least every 4 years concludes that the effects of climate change are already being felt in communities throughout the United States and that without substantial and sustained mitigation efforts, climate change will cause significant economic losses in the United States.

One of the 12 key summary findings states: “Communities, governments, and businesses are working to reduce risks from and costs asso­ciated with climate change by taking action to lower greenhouse gas emissions and implement adaptation strategies. While mitigation and adaptation efforts have expanded substantially in the last four years, they do not yet approach the scale considered necessary to avoid substantial damages to the economy, environment, and human health over the coming decades.”

About Gevo
Gevo is a next generation “low-carbon” fuel company focused on the development and commercialization of renewable alternatives to petroleum-based products. Low-carbon fuels reduce the carbon intensity, or the level of greenhouse gas emissions, compared to standard fossil-based fuels across their lifecycle. The most common low-carbon fuels are renewable fuels. Gevo is focused on the development and production of mainstream fuels like gasoline and jet fuel using renewable feedstocks that have the potential to lower greenhouse gas emissions at a meaningful scale and enhance agricultural production, including food and other related products. In addition to serving the low-carbon fuel markets, through Gevo’s technology, Gevo can also serve markets for the production of chemical intermediate products for solvents, plastics, and building block chemicals.
